Treatment Options

Anatomic Total Shoulder Replacement (TSA)

Surgery
Best for:Shoulder arthritis with intact rotator cuff
Tech:Anatomic implants, cemented or press-fit humeral component
Advantage:Pain relief, restored function, natural shoulder mechanics

Reverse Shoulder Arthroplasty (RSA)

Surgery
Best for:Cuff tear arthropathy, massive irreparable cuff tear
Tech:Reversed ball-and-socket design, deltoid-powered motion
Advantage:Reliable pain relief even without functioning rotator cuff

Common Questions

What is the difference between anatomic and reverse shoulder replacement?
Anatomic replaces the worn surfaces with similar anatomy, requiring intact rotator cuff. Reverse switches the ball and socket, allowing the deltoid to power the arm without a functioning rotator cuff.
How long does a shoulder replacement last?
Modern shoulder replacements last 10-20 years. Reverse shoulders have slightly higher loosening rates than anatomic. Younger patients may eventually need revision.
When can I return to activities after shoulder replacement?
Desk work: 2-4 weeks. Driving: 4-6 weeks. Light activities: 6-8 weeks. Golf/tennis: 3-4 months. Heavy lifting: 4-6 months. Reverse shoulders have permanent lifting restrictions (<10 lbs overhead).
Is reverse shoulder replacement as good as anatomic?
For cuff tear arthropathy, reverse provides more reliable pain relief and better function than anatomic would with a deficient cuff. However, range of motion is typically less than anatomic replacement.
